MAXSafe Retractable Safety Reels are the standard exclusion zone tool across Australian mining operations. Available in 9m and 20m tape lengths with either magnetic or bolt-mount options, they allow maintenance teams to define, adjust, and remove exclusion zones in seconds – without tools, without scaffolding, and without taking workers off the job.
Both mount types use the same MAXSafe reel cassette. The difference is how they attach to site infrastructure — and that choice has a direct impact on how quickly your crew can respond when work scope changes mid-shift.
Attaches to any steel surface — machinery, storage frames, elevated walkway rails — without drilling or fasteners. A crew member can relocate an entire exclusion zone anchor point in under 30 seconds. The preferred choice for shutdown programs and environments where exclusion zone boundaries shift across tasks or shift changes.
Permanently drilled to a fixed structure, providing a consistent, stable anchor point for zones that don’t move. The preferred choice for repeat-use access control points — workshop machine entries, bay doorways, and processing line access points where the exclusion boundary is the same every time.

For a standard single-machine exclusion zone with anchor points close together, the 9m reel is typically sufficient. For large plant exclusion zones or cross-bay barriers where anchor points are spread further apart, the 20m reel is the right choice. If you’re unsure, the 20m provides the most flexibility.
Yes — the MAXSafe Support Stand is designed specifically for this. It provides a freestanding base for magnetic reels in open areas where no steel structure is available. Available in fixed, wheeled, and forklift-movable configurations depending on how frequently you need to reposition.
The tape and cassette components are UV-stabilised and rated for prolonged outdoor exposure. The cassette housing is robust enough to handle dust, vibration, and the physical handling demands of shutdown environments. Regular inspection of the tape and retract mechanism is recommended during extended deployments.
